Understanding Brake Wear as a System, Not a Symptom


Most drivers wait for a symptom—noise, vibration, or a warning light—before thinking seriously about brake maintenance. A more refined approach treats the entire brake system as a coordinated ecosystem in which each component influences the others.


Your pads are only one part of a much larger picture. Rotors, calipers, brake lines, brake fluid, hoses, wheel bearings, and even tires all affect how your vehicle slows and stops. Slightly uneven rotor thickness can encourage premature pad wear. Tired rubber hoses can expand under pressure, degrading pedal feel. Contaminated fluid can overheat and introduce air bubbles, softening the pedal just when you need firmness most.


When you or your technician inspect the brakes, the goal should not be simply to confirm that “pads are above the minimum.” Instead, assess how evenly they are wearing left to right, whether there are subtle heat marks on the rotors, if any seals are weeping, and whether the pedal feel is consistent and repeatable. This system-level awareness is what separates routine servicing from truly elevated maintenance.

1. Treat Brake Fluid as a Safety Component, Not a Line Item


Brake fluid is often treated as an afterthought, replaced only when a service schedule demands it. For a driver who values consistent, predictable braking, fluid deserves the same respect as pads and rotors.


Brake fluid is hygroscopic—it naturally absorbs moisture over time. That moisture reduces the fluid’s boiling point, making it more likely to vaporize under heavy braking. The result can be pedal fade, longer stopping distances, and a vague, inconsistent brake feel. Even if you rarely drive aggressively, long downhill grades, warm climates, or towing can generate enough heat to expose weak fluid.


Instead of waiting for a calendar reminder, consider proactive brake fluid testing every service interval. Many shops can measure moisture content or boiling point. If your driving involves mountains, high speeds, or frequent stop‑and‑go traffic, replacing brake fluid more often than the generic schedule recommends is not overkill—it is an intelligent safety choice.


2. Respect Heat Patterns: What Your Rotors Are Telling You


Most drivers only think about rotors when they are warped or noisy. A more elevated approach looks at them as a record of how the brakes have been used and how they might behave in the future.


Subtle clues matter. Light, even surface discoloration is generally normal. But pronounced blue or purple spots, radial heat cracks, or uneven sheen between the left and right sides can signal a caliper that is dragging, a pad that is not making uniform contact, or a driver habit that is overly harsh on the system. Even if you do not feel a vibration yet, such heat patterns often precede warped rotors or glazed pads.


When rotors are resurfaced or replaced, ask how their thickness compares to the minimum specification and whether there is adequate margin left for future refinishing. A rotor that barely clears the minimum may pass inspection today but will be less able to manage heat tomorrow, especially during emergency stops.


3. Caliper Condition: The “Silent Influence” on Brake Quality


Calipers are rarely discussed outside of performance circles, yet they are central to how gracefully your car stops. Pads and rotors may be the visible wear items, but calipers determine how evenly pressure is applied to them.


Over time, guide pins can stick, seals may harden, and pistons can develop uneven movement. None of this necessarily triggers a dashboard warning. Instead, you see it in subtle ways—one wheel that accumulates more brake dust, a slightly warmer wheel after a drive, or pads that wear at different rates on the same axle.


During a brake service, a discerning driver will want the calipers fully inspected, cleaned, and lubricated, not merely checked for obvious leaks. Ask whether the technician measured pad thickness on the inner and outer sides of each wheel; a significant difference can reveal a caliper that is not sliding freely. Addressing that early preserves rotors, extends pad life, and maintains the even, composed braking feel you expect.


4. Pairing Tires and Brakes: The Overlooked Partnership


Even the finest brake components are limited by the grip of the tires they work through. Stopping power is not just about calipers and pads; it is about the relationship between friction at the rotor and traction at the road.


Older or hardened tires, even if they still show legal tread depth, can significantly lengthen stopping distances—especially in wet or cold conditions. A driver who invests in premium brakes but neglects tire condition is leaving safety and performance on the table. Similarly, mismatched tire brands or tread patterns across the same axle can lead to uneven braking response and subtle instability during hard stops.


Align your tire choices with your braking expectations. If you value short, consistent stopping distances and refined control, choose tires with proven braking performance, not just long tread life. Inspect sidewalls for age-related cracking and replace tires based on age and performance, not merely on tread depth.


5. Listening Beyond the Squeal: Subtle Feedback You Should Not Ignore


Most people react only to loud brake squeals, assuming silence equals safety. A more nuanced driver listens for quieter, early-stage cues that something may be changing.


A faint chirp only during the last moments of a stop, a slight “graunch” when backing out of a parking space, a pedal that feels marginally softer on humid days, or a very light steering wheel shimmy under firm braking—all of these small signals can precede more serious issues. They may point to early pad glazing, slight rotor unevenness, or developing suspension wear that interacts with brake performance.


Make a habit of evaluating how your vehicle stops a few times per month: a controlled firm stop from moderate speed on a straight, empty road, hands lightly on the wheel, enough pressure to meaningfully load the system but not trigger ABS. Pay attention to noise, vibration, pedal travel, and how straight the car remains. This kind of deliberate “status check” can reveal small changes early, when corrections are simpler and less expensive.


Elevating Routine Service into a Brake Care Strategy


Most maintenance plans are reactive: fix what is worn, replace what is broken. For the driver serious about brake safety, the goal should be a strategy rather than a schedule.


That strategy might include aligning brake inspections with tire rotations, so the full wheel-end assembly is examined together. It may involve maintaining a written record of pad and rotor measurements, fluid changes, and tire condition, allowing you to see trends instead of isolated data points. It could also include choosing a trusted shop that is equipped to measure rotor runout, verify caliper function, and test brake fluid quality—not simply glance at pad thickness.


Equally important is the way you drive. Smooth, anticipatory braking habits lower brake temperatures, reduce wear, and keep the system performing at its peak when you truly need it. The reward is not merely longer-lasting parts, but a consistent, composed braking experience day after day.
